;;; zygo.el-1.0
;;; (Setq *zygo-version-string* "1.0") ; update this below when changing.
;;;
;;; zygo.el - is a pair of modes for sending lines from a
;;; script (sender) to a comint-started inferior
;;; (receiver) process. We use Ctrl-n by default as
;;; the "send this line and step" key. This enables
;;; one to step through scripts easily when working
;;; with an interpreter.
;;;
;;; License: This minimal pair of (major and inferior) modes
;;; was derived from the Emacs Octave Support modes in
;;; octave-mod.el and octave-inf.el, with a little help
;;; (and alot of inspiration) from the ess-mode.el for
;;; R. As such it falls under the GNU General Public
;;; License version 3 or later. The GPL applies solely
;;; to this single file and does not apply to any
;;; other files distributed here.
;;;
;;; Copyright (C) 2016, Author: Jason E. Aten
;;;
;;; how to install:
;;;
;;; (1) If you are changing which interpreter you want to use, examine
;;; and adjust the "commonly-adjusted parameters" section just below.
;;;
;;; (2) Copy zygo-mode.el into your ~/.emacs.d/ directory.
;;;
;;; (3) Then put this in your .emacs:
;;;
;;; (load "/home/jaten/.emacs.d/zygo.el") ; adjust path to fit your home directory.
;;; (require 'zygo-mode)
;;; (global-set-key "\C-n" 'zygo-send-line)
;;;
;;; (4) Optionally for speed, M-x byte-compile-file <enter>
;;; ~/.emacs.d/zygo.el <enter>
;;;
;;; (5) To use, do 'M-x run-zygo' to start the interpreter. Open
;;; your script and in the script buffer do 'M-x zygo-mode'.
;;;
;;; Or, open a file with an automatically recognized extension
;;; (as specified below) and press 'C-n' on the first line
;;; you want executed in the interpreter.
;; To over-ride parameters, skip down to the "commonly-adjusted
;; parameters" section below these declarations.
;;
;; Here we just document the typically overriden parameters of interest.
;; NB: these just give defaults, which the setq settings below will override.
;; Putting them here keeps the byte-compiler from complaining.
(defvar *inferior-zygo-program* "zygo"
"Program invoked by `inferior-zygo'.")
(defvar *inferior-zygo-buffer* "*zygo*"
"*Name of buffer for running an inferior zygo process.")
(defvar *inferior-zygo-regex-prompt* "[^\(zygo>\)\|\(\.\.\.\)]*[> ]"
"Regexp to match prompts for the inferior Zygo process.")
(setq *inferior-zygo-regex-prompt* "[^\(zygo>\)\|\(\.\.\.\)]*[> ]")
(defvar *zygo-keypress-to-sendline* (kbd "C-n")
"keypress that, when in a pure mode script, sends a line to the interpreter
and then steps to the next line.")
(defvar *zygo-keypress-to-send-sexp-jdev* (kbd "C-u")
"keypress that sends the next sexp to the repl, and advances past it.")
(defvar *zygo-keypress-to-send-sexp-jdev-prev* (kbd "C-p")
"keypress that sends the previous sexp to the repl")
(defvar *zygo-version-string* "1.0"
"version of zygo.el currently running.")
;; ================================================
;; ================================================
;; begin commonly-adjusted parameters
;; the name of the interpreter to run
;(setq *inferior-zygo-program* "/Users/jaten/bin/zygo")
(setq *inferior-zygo-program* "zygo")
;; the name of the buffer to run the interpreter in
(setq *inferior-zygo-buffer* "*zygo*")
;; the comment character
(setq *inferior-zygo-comment-char* "//")
(setq comment-start *inferior-zygo-comment-char*)
(setq comment-end nil)
(setq comment-column 4)
;; file extensions that indicate we should automatically enter zygo mode...
(setq auto-mode-alist (cons '("\\.zy$" . zygo-mode) auto-mode-alist))
;; regexp to know when interpreter output is done and we are at a prompt.
;;(setq *inferior-zygo-regex-prompt* "[^\(zygo>\)\|\(\.\.\.\)]*[> ]")
;; keypress that, when in a zygo-mode script, sends a line to the interpreter
;; and then steps to the next line.
(setq *zygo-keypress-to-sendline* (kbd "C-n"))
;; keypress that, when in a zygo-mode script, sends an sexp to the repl
;; and then steps to the next line.
(setq *zygo-keypress-to-send-sexp-jdev* (kbd "C-9"))
(setq *zygo-keypress-to-send-sexp-jdev-prev* (kbd "C-p"))
;; end commonly-adjusted parameters
;; ================================================
;; ================================================
(defvar inferior-zygo-output-list nil)
(defvar inferior-zygo-output-string nil)
(defvar inferior-zygo-receive-in-progress nil)
(defvar inferior-zygo-process nil)
(defvar zygo-mode-hook nil
"*Hook to be run when Zygo mode is started.")
(defvar zygo-send-show-buffer t
"*Non-nil means display `*inferior-zygo-buffer*' after sending to it.")
(setq zygo-send-show-buffer t)
(defvar zygo-send-line-auto-forward nil
"*Control auto-forward after sending to the inferior Zygo process.
Non-nil means always go to the next Zygo code line after sending.")
(setq zygo-send-line-auto-forward nil)
(defvar zygo-send-echo-input t
"*Non-nil means echo input sent to the inferior Zygo process.")
(setq zygo-send-echo-input t)
(defvar *zygo-known-lisps*)
(setq *zygo-known-lisps* '((:sysname "ccl" :syspath "/home/jaten/uns/bin/ccl64" :syspromptregex "[^[?]]*[?] ")
(:sysname "sbcl" :syspath "/usr/bin/sbcl" :syspromptregex "[^>]*> ")
(:sysname "cmucl" :syspath "/usr/local/bin/lisp" :syspromptregex "[^>]*> ")))
;; try to hide the ctrl-M carriage returns that ipython generates.
(defun remove-dos-eol ()
"Do not show ^M in files containing mixed UNIX and DOS line endings."
(interactive)
(with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(setq buffer-display-table (make-display-table))
(aset buffer-display-table ?\^M [])))
;;; Motion
(defun zygo-next-code-line (&optional arg)
"Move ARG lines of Zygo code forward (backward if ARG is negative).
Skips past all empty and comment lines. Default for ARG is 1.
On success, return 0. Otherwise, go as far as possible and return -1."
(interactive "p")
(or arg (setq arg 1))
(beginning-of-line)
(let ((n 0)
(inc (if (> arg 0) 1 -1)))
(while (and (/= arg 0) (= n 0))
(setq n (forward-line inc))
(while (and (= n 0)
(looking-at "\\s-*\\($\\|\\s<\\)"))
(setq n (forward-line inc)))
(setq arg (- arg inc)))
n))
(defun zygo-previous-code-line (&optional arg)
"Move ARG lines of Zygo code backward (forward if ARG is negative).
Skips past all empty and comment lines. Default for ARG is 1.
On success, return 0. Otherwise, go as far as possible and return -1."
(interactive "p")
(or arg (setq arg 1))
(zygo-next-code-line (- arg)))
;;; Communication with the inferior Zygo process
(defun zygo-kill-process ()
"Kill inferior Zygo process and its buffer."
(interactive)
(if inferior-zygo-process
(progn
(process-send-string inferior-zygo-process "quit;\n")
(accept-process-output inferior-zygo-process)))
(if *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(kill-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*)))
(defun zygo-show-process-buffer ()
"Make sure that `*inferior-zygo-buffer*' is displayed."
(interactive)
(if (get-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*)
(display-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*)
(message "No buffer named %s" *inferior-zygo-buffer*)))
(defun zygo-hide-process-buffer ()
"Delete all windows that display `*inferior-zygo-buffer*'."
(interactive)
(if (get-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*)
(delete-windows-on *inferior-zygo-buffer*)
(message "No buffer named %s" *inferior-zygo-buffer*)))
(defun zygo-send-region (beg end)
"Send current region to the inferior Zygo process."
(interactive "r")
(inferior-zygo t)
(let ((proc inferior-zygo-process)
(string (buffer-substring-no-properties beg end))
line)
(if (string-equal string "")
(setq string "\n"))
(with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(setq inferior-zygo-output-list nil)
(while (not (string-equal string ""))
(if (string-match "\n" string)
(setq line (substring string 0 (match-beginning 0))
string (substring string (match-end 0)))
(setq line string string ""))
(setq inferior-zygo-receive-in-progress t)
(inferior-zygo-send-list-and-digest (list (concat line "\n")))
;; (inferior-zygo-send-list-and-digest (list (concat "%cpaste\n" line "\n--\n")))
(while inferior-zygo-receive-in-progress
(accept-process-output proc))
(insert-before-markers
(mapconcat 'identity
(append
(if zygo-send-echo-input (list line) (list ""))
(mapcar 'inferior-zygo-strip-ctrl-g
inferior-zygo-output-list)
(list inferior-zygo-output-string))
"\n")))))
(if zygo-send-show-buffer
(zygo-eob)))
;; test out moving the inf buffer to end...
(defun zygo-eob ()
(interactive)
(let* ((mywin (display-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*))
(bl (with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(line-number-at-pos (point-min))))
(cl (with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(line-number-at-pos (window-point mywin))))
(el (with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(goto-char (point-max))
(line-number-at-pos))))
;;;(message "bl is %d, el is %d, cl is %d, el-cl is %d" bl el cl (- el cl))
(setq other-window-scroll-buffer (get-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*))
(scroll-other-window (- el cl))
(with-current-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*
(goto-char (point-max))
(set-window-point mywin (point-max)))
(display-buffer *inferior-zygo-buffer*)
))
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
;; the entire point of zygo-mode : to enable the use
;; of zygo-send-line with a single keypress.
;;
(defun zygo-send-line (&optional arg)
"Send current Zygo code line to the inferior Zygo process.
With positive prefix ARG, send that many lines.
If `zygo-send-line-auto-forward' is non-nil, go to the next unsent
code line."
(interactive "P")
(or arg (setq arg 1))
(if (> arg 0)
(let (beg end)
(beginning-of-line)
(setq beg (point))
(zygo-next-code-line (- arg 1))
(end-of-line)
(setq end (point))
(if zygo-send-line-auto-forward
(zygo-next-code-line 1)
(forward-line 1))
(zygo-send-region beg end))))
